WILMINGTON, Ohio – The Wilmington College volleyball team hosts the University of Mount Union for an Ohio Athletic Conference (OAC) contest on Saturday. First serve is scheduled for 3 p.m.

The Teams: Wilmington and Mount Union. The Fightin' Quakers are 5-14 overall and 0-2 in conference play after a pair of straight-set losses at Heidelberg University and at Muskingum University . The Purple Raiders are 18-2 overall and 1-1 in the OAC after falling to Otterbein University in straight sets on Saturday.

The Coaches: Tim O'Brien enters his fourth year as Wilmington's head volleyball coach. He has improved the Quakers' wins total each of his first three seasons and is looking to break through in the Ohio Athletic Conference (OAC) this season. A 2012 graduate of Siena Heights University, O'Brien was a four-year letter-winner for the Saints' men's volleyball, team and ranks in seven career and seasonal program records. Melissa Mahnke, a 2010 alumnae of Mount Union and two-time All-American, is in her fourth season as Mount Union's head coach. The Purple Raiders went 25-5 under her guidance last season.

The Players: Jillian Wesco leads Wilmington with 123 kills while also contributing 234 digs in the back row, second-best on the team. Taylor McCuistion, Mariella Szrom and Karrah Wind have all put down at least 78 kills while Amber Rox also averages over one kill per set. Three Quakers – Jacie Koontz, Grace Ewing and Summer Wilbur – split the setting duties with Kootnz and Wilbur dishing out over three assists per set. Defensively, Szrom has recorded 37 blocks while Karley Schlensker averages 4.57 digs per set as Wilmington's libero. Three Purple Raiders – Madelin DiBease, Marlee Peck and Kyleigh Jackson – all have over 140 kills on the season and along with Breanna Arnett and Kirsten Powell, they average over two kills per set. Carly Stepic dishes out over 10 assists per set while Peck leads the team in blocks with 62. In the Mount Union back row, Allison Baird averages 4.94 digs per set.

AVCA Top 25 Poll: Mount Union is not ranked in the most recent AVCA Top 25 Poll, but is receiving nine votes.

Senior Day: Though athletically just juniors, Amber Rox and Summer Wilbur will graduate this spring from Wilmington and will not be returning for their final year of eligibility next fall. A brief ceremony will be held for them prior to the match.
